|
Home » Tell us your thoughts on Security News Desk Issue 21
|
Managing EDITOR
Sales Manager
Create your free account today and get instant access to exclusive industry insights, expert analysis, and breaking security news.
© Hand Media International LTD 2025. All rights reserved.